Subject: Cron-to-Windmere cut-over summary

Hello plugin authors — as of this morning, all scheduled jobs on the Larkspur platform have been migrated from host-level cron to the Windmere workflow engine. Legacy crontabs have been disabled but preserved for thirty days. Plugins registering scheduled tasks must now declare them via the Windmere manifest; direct cron registration will be rejected. The engine settings your plugins will run under are the following.

settings of kahag-bagug:
[quenath]
port = 6379
region = outer-2
host = quenath.nelvrocorp.internal
timeout_ms = 2000
retries = 3

Break-glass access for Trailmark's offline survey mode is reserved for incidents where field devices cannot sync and the cached credential store must be unsealed manually. Security reviewers should confirm that each use is logged in the Trailmark incident ledger and countersigned within 24 hours. The sealed envelope procedure was retired last quarter; the current recovery passphrase for the offline vault appears immediately below this paragraph.

strongbox words: wenix-ulador

## Matchwell Release Runbook — GC Pauses

During rollout of the Pairlane matching service, expect elevated GC pauses for ~10 minutes while the candidate cache warms. Pauses above 400ms trigger the pager; acknowledge but do not roll back unless they persist past warm-up. If pauses continue, reduce heap target to 70% and redeploy. Historical incidents show this stabilizes matching latency within two cycles. Before promoting the build, verify the artifact signature against the key below.

deploy key for kajof-fajop: bky6_gDHw9Q

Ticket #4182 — Configuration drift on the Brindlewick transcode farm

During the quarterly audit we found that six worker nodes in the Halford cluster are running settings that diverge from the baseline committed to the Quillbox repo. The drift affects codec presets, queue depth, and scratch-disk retention, and was likely introduced by a manual hotfix in March that never got backported. No evidence of tampering so far, but please review the deltas. The current live values on the affected nodes are as follows.

deployment values, fahap-hahaf:
[casdor]
port = 9200
region = south-2
host = casdor.qirvanworks.corp
timeout_ms = 3000
retries = 4